Pseudodictyosphaerium densum (Hindák) Hindák 1988

Publication Details
Pseudodictyosphaerium densum (Hindák) Hindák 1988: 76

Published in: Hindák, F. (1988). Studies on the chlorococcal algae (Chlorophyceae). IV. Biologické Práce 34(1/2): 1-264.

Request PDF

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Pseudodictyosphaerium is Pseudodictyosphaerium fluviatile (Hindák) Hindák.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Mychonastes densus (Hindák) Krienitz, C.Bock, Dadheech & Proschold .

Basionym
Dictyosphaerium densum Hindák

Type Information
Type locality: Slovakia: Bratislava: river Danube; (Index Nominum Algarum) Iconotypus: fig 32: 1: Autumn 1981; plankton; (Index Nominum Algarum)

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), dense (Stearn 1973).

General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
